Position Summary:

The Community Manager will manage the apartment community as a business unit to achieve pre-determined marketing and financial results. The Community Manager trains, supervises and motivates on-site office personnel.

Job Responsibilities:

Assists Regional Manager in maintaining the physical asset and maximizing the financial returns from that asset in accordance with the owners' objectives.

Responsible for hiring, training, supervising, and terminating all community personnel.

Ensures staff compliance with company policies and procedures.

Ensures staff performance of duties on a timely basis.

Assists with special projects and administrative tasks.

Other responsibilities include but are not limited to: Marketing, leasing, financial reporting and control, resident relations.

Experience/Skills:

On-site experience with at least three years of experience as an Apartment Community Manager is required.

Must be a strong team player with good communication and people skills and ability to solve problems, manage time and set priorities;

Must be detail oriented, flexible and well organized.

Must have a working knowledge of computers, finance, management and marketing.

Must be capable of preparing and analyzing budgets/financial forecasts and working within a budget.

CAM or other property management certification preferred.
